This token was launched in 2011 as a faster, lighter version of Bitcoin. It’s built on the same general idea, is decentralized, is peer-to-peer, and has no middlemen, but with some practical improvements.
I think the biggest win is speed. Transactions confirm way quicker than Bitcoin, which makes a big difference when you’re dealing with time-sensitive stuff like casino deposits or withdrawals.
It also runs cheaper. I’ve paid next to nothing in fees when using it, even during peak traffic times. That alone puts it ahead of a few other coins I’ve tested. Ethereum, for example, can sting you with random gas fees, and I’ve seen Bitcoin transactions sit pending for way too long. I usually don’t have to worry about either when I use this method.
The idea behind it was to make a coin that worked better for everyday payments, and I honestly think it does that well. I also like that it’s stayed consistent. Some coins come and go, or get pumped and dumped into irrelevance. This payment just does what it was made to do.

I’ve used this coin enough times at online casinos to get a feel for how it performs, and I quite like it. Payments usually go through without any weird holdups, and fees are low enough that I don’t think twice about depositing or withdrawing smaller amounts.
The token runs on a proof-of-work system, similar to Bitcoin, but it’s built to process blocks faster. Instead of waiting around ten minutes like you might with Bitcoin, Litecoin confirms transactions every two and a half minutes. That speed makes a difference. I’ve had deposits show up in my casino balance in just a few minutes, which keeps things moving when I’m ready to play.
What I like most is how steady it feels. I’m not watching it fluctuate like crazy or wondering if the network’s going to choke during busy hours. Of course, it’s not flawless, but I’ve found it reliable. That matters when you’re trying to cash out and don’t want to sit around refreshing your wallet.

Before you can use this coin at a casino, you’ll need somewhere to store it. That means getting a wallet. And please don’t check your jacket or pants — it’s not that kind of wallet. I’m talking about a digital wallet.
I think what works best depends on how you like to manage your crypto. Some people want full control, others just want something easy and fast. The table below shows the two different types.
| Wallet Type | Differences | Examples | What It Offers |
| Custodial | Managed by the wallet you use | Binance, Coinbase | Stored by a third party, easy to use, no need to manage seed phrases |
| Non-Custodial | Fully managed by you | Trust Wallet, Exodus, Atomic | Full control of your funds, you hold the keys, no outside access |
If you’re more security-focused, you might want to go with something like Ledger. It’s a hardware wallet, so it’s not as quick for casual gambling, but it does offer peace of mind if you’re holding larger amounts of this token for a while.
From my experience, mobile wallets tend to hit the sweet spot for gambling. They’re easy to set up, fast to access, and you’re not stuck waiting around for confirmation emails or switching between devices.

Depositing with Litecoin isn’t complicated. If you’ve never used crypto before, the first time might feel a bit awkward, but once you’ve done it, the whole process becomes quite easy to follow and complete. I’ve gone through the steps more times than I can count, and it usually takes less than five minutes from start to finish.
Step 1: Make sure you have some of this coin in your wallet
Whether you’re using a mobile wallet like Trust Wallet or an exchange wallet like Binance, just confirm your balance is ready. Doesn’t matter which one, as long as you’re in control of the funds.
Step 2: Go to the casino’s deposit section
Head to the cashier or deposit area of your chosen casino. From the list of payment methods, select Litecoin.
Step 3: Copy the deposit address
The site will show a Litecoin address and usually a QR code. Copy the address exactly as shown. You can also scan the QR code with your wallet app if you want.

Step 4: Double-check the address
I recommend to always double-check this part, because crypto doesn’t come with a safety net, and if you send funds to the wrong address, they’re gone.
Step 5: Confirm and send the payment
Paste the address into your wallet, enter the amount, and confirm the transaction. Once you send the payment, the network handles the rest. I’ve noticed deposits usually go through pretty quickly.
Step 6: Wait for the confirmation
Most of the time, deposits with this payment option confirm within a few minutes. Some casinos wait for one or two confirmations before crediting your balance, but it rarely takes long. I’ve had plenty of deposits clear in under five minutes, which is one of the better parts of using this token.

Is this token safe for gambling?
I’d say so, yes. As long as the site is legit, Litecoin is just as safe as any other method. Just remember to double-check wallet addresses, there’s no undo button in crypto.
Are there fees when using Litecoin?
Fees are one of the reasons I like it. They’re usually just a few cents, which is a huge relief compared to coins like Ethereum that can spike out of nowhere.
How long do deposits with this crypto take?
In most cases, I see deposits show up in my account within five minutes. It depends on the casino, but even with one or two confirmations, it’s still pretty fast.
Which wallet should I use for this coin?
I’ve had the best luck with mobile wallets like Trust Wallet and Exodus. They’re quick, simple, and you stay in full control. If you’re using a larger balance, maybe look at a hardware wallet like Ledger.
Do all casinos support this coin?
Not all of them, but I’d say most crypto-friendly casinos do. I see Litecoin listed alongside Bitcoin and USDT pretty regularly these days.
Is Litecoin better than Bitcoin or Ethereum for casinos?
Depends on what you’re after, but personally, I think it’s better than them when it comes to payments. It confirms faster than Bitcoin and doesn’t hit you with random fees like Ethereum sometimes does.
